Budget of course! I am looking for food, decoration and game ideas. I would also like a craft or two. I was thinking a make your own sword and maybe shield would be fun for them. My son will be turning 9.
 
All I can come up with is a "Pin the Snake on Medusa" game ... but I don't know much about the book series - just seen the film. However, there were a few blogs that offered up some good suggestions:
1. The invitations - make them look like a scroll and tie them closed with a ribbon. You can make the paper look older by staining it with coffee and burning the edges.
2. Make a Sign to put over your door called "Camp Half Blood." If you choose to have competitions as they did at the camp in the book then make up some gold, silver and bronze medals.
3. Have swords for them and let them make up a shield out of foam board and decorate it.
4. Have a treasure hunt. One lady make a treasure hunt with clues leading the children at one point to a dart board with balloons they had to pop to get the clue and then finally to a sword that they would use to kill the Minotaur. This was really a durable sword or pinata stick and the Minotaur was an altered cow pinata - easy to make it look a little more evil. I'm going to suggest that if you do the clues thing - write some of them in Greek and give them a guide to "decode" it. =)
5. She also recommended a blue cake as in the book Percy's mom feeds him blue food on special occasions.

You could also do something with the green pearls...they could split into teams to complete a series of 3 relays or 3 sets of relays and each team that wins the relay gets a pearl...the relays could be puzzle solving...they could have to waterpaint a specific object the fastest with their mouth and not use hands...another one of the relays could be who can eat 3 flower candies or cookies the fastest...you could have play doh and see who can sculpt a sowrd and shield the fastest too...

I know that Percy's mom is into blue food but what about some greek foods too? Baklava is a great dessert, gooey and crispy at the same time. Pastitso (like a lasagna) or Spanikopita (cheese and spinach pies)

I am not an adventurous eater but OMG some greek foods are SO good.

As for games...what about giving the kids some recylables (bottles, styrofoam, etc) and have them make their own chariots and then using a ramp have chariot races. The last one standing win a laurel wreath for his head.
